EDOG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2019 in Review
14 of the 5,076 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in ALPS Emerging Sector Dividend Dogs ETF (EDOG) for Q4 2019, worth a combined $9.61M — down 11% from $10.8M a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 3 funds opened new EDOG positions and 1 closed out — a net gain of 2 holders — while 4 added to existing stakes and 7 trimmed.
The largest buyer was Flow Traders U.S., opening a new position worth an estimated $231K. The largest seller was Jane Street, cutting an estimated $1.51M.
